** The Jeep repair and modification market in the Seaside Park area is robust and highly specialized, driven by the local beach and off-road culture. The quality of service is generally high, with several shops competing on expertise rather than just price. Competition is strong among the top-tier specialists, who differentiate themselves through certifications (such as from Mopar, Teraflex, or Fox) and a proven track record with complex projects. Typical pricing is at a premium compared to standard automotive repair, reflecting the specialized tools, training, and time required for 4x4 systems and modifications. A basic lift kit installation can range from $1,000 to $3,000+, while advanced work like engine swaps or differential re-gearing can easily exceed $10,000. The customer base consists largely of dedicated enthusiasts and practical owners who require vehicles capable of handling beach driving and Northeast terrain, creating a steady demand for both repair and upgrade services.

Common questions about jeep repair services in Seaside Park, NJ
Given our coastal environment, rust prevention and undercarriage inspections are critical due to salt air and sand. We also frequently service 4WD systems and suspension components for Jeeps used on Island Beach State Park's sandy trails, and address issues from potholes on local roads like Central Avenue.
Look for shops in Seaside Park or nearby towns like Toms River that are certified by the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E) and have specific experience with Jeep models. Checking for local online reviews and asking for recommendations from other local Jeep owners at community events can also lead you to trusted specialists.
Labor rates in Seaside Park are generally competitive with the surrounding Ocean County region. However, the specialized nature of Jeep repairs, particularly for 4x4 systems, can influence cost. It's always wise to get a detailed written estimate that accounts for the specific parts and labor required for your repair.
You should have the 4WD system serviced and tested before the beach driving season starts, typically before Memorial Day, to ensure it's ready for the sand at Island Beach State Park. Also seek service immediately if you hear unusual noises from the drivetrain or experience difficulty engaging 4WD, especially after driving through flooded streets or deep puddles from coastal storms.
The salty, humid air accelerates corrosion, making fluid changes (especially brake fluid) and frequent undercarriage washes more important than in inland areas. Furthermore, if you drive on the beach, you should adhere to a stricter schedule for air filter changes and cleaning sand from the undercarriage and brake components to prevent premature wear.
